Apple and Chocolate Muffins: A Sweet Indulgence

Preparation time: 15 minutes
Baking time: 25-35 minutes
Total time: 40-50 minutes
Servings: 12 muffins

Ingredients

- 100 g butter (at room temperature)
- 100 g sugar
- 2 eggs (separated)
- Seeds from 1 vanilla pod
- 1 teaspoon rum essence
- 150 ml milk
- 1 large green apple, peeled and grated
- 1 large red apple, peeled and grated
- Juice of 1 lemon
- 400 g flour
- 1 packet baking powder
- 100 g hazelnut chocolate spread

Preparing the Muffins

Step 1: Prepare the oven and the tray

Before you start cooking, preheat the oven to 190 °C. While it preheats, line a muffin tray with special cups. This will make it easier to remove the muffins after baking and ensure a nice shape.

Step 2: Mixing the wet ingredients

In a large bowl, beat the butter with the sugar until the mixture becomes creamy and fluffy. This step is essential as the incorporated air helps achieve light muffins. Add the egg yolks and continue mixing. Then, add the vanilla seeds, rum essence, milk, grated apples, and lemon juice. Mix well to combine all these flavorful ingredients.

Step 3: Mixing the dry ingredients

In another bowl, mix the flour with the baking powder. This step ensures that the leavening agents are evenly distributed in the dough. Then, gently fold the flour mixture into the butter and apple mixture. Mix lightly, being careful not to overmix, to maintain the muffins' fluffy texture.

Step 4: Beating the egg whites

In another clean bowl, beat the egg whites with a pinch of salt until frothy. This step is crucial for giving the muffins an airy texture. Carefully fold the beaten egg whites into the flour mixture using a spatula to avoid losing the air from the whites.

Step 5: Filling the muffin cups

Fill each muffin cup with batter, leaving about 1/3 of the cup free to allow the muffins to rise. Place a teaspoon of hazelnut chocolate spread in the center of each muffin, then add a tablespoon of batter on top. This detail will create a sweet surprise in every bite.

Step 6: Baking

Place the tray in the preheated oven and let the muffins bake for 25-35 minutes, or until they are golden and have risen nicely. An easy way to check if they are done is to insert a toothpick into the center of one; if it comes out clean, the muffins are ready.

Step 7: Cooling and serving

After the muffins are baked, let them cool in the tray for 5 minutes, then transfer them to a cooling rack. These muffins are delicious warm but also at room temperature. You can serve them with a cup of tea or coffee for a perfect experience.

Helpful Tips

- Choosing apples: Use crispy and juicy apples to achieve muffins with a pleasant texture. Green apples add a note of acidity that balances the sweetness of the chocolate.
- Vegan option: You can replace the butter with coconut oil and the eggs with banana puree or plant-based yogurt for a vegan version.
- Flavor enhancements: Add cinnamon or nutmeg to the batter for an extra flavor boost.
- Keeping fresh: Muffins keep well in an airtight container for 2-3 days, but you can freeze them to enjoy later.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I use other fruits?
Yes, you can experiment with other fruits like pears or peaches to create muffins with different flavors.

2. How can I improve the texture?
Make sure not to overmix the batter and that the egg whites are beaten well to achieve an airy texture.

3. Can I replace the chocolate spread?
Of course! You can use jam, cream cheese, or even a piece of dark chocolate for an intense flavor.
